DOOR
STORAGE
Door bins and shelves are provided for convenient storage of jars, bottles,
and cans. Frequently used items can be quickly selected.
Some models have door bins that can accommodate
gallon-sized plastic
drink containers and economy-sized
jars and containers. Some bins are
adjustable for maximum storage capacity.
The dairy compartment, which is warmer than the general food storage section,
is intended for short term storage of cheese, spreads, or butter.
ADJUSTABLE
DOOR
BINS
Some models have adjustable door bins that can be moved to suit individual
needs.
To move door bins
1.
Lift bin straight up.
2.
Remove bin.
3.
Place bin in desired position.
4.
Lower bin onto supports until locked in place.
